Admissions Requirements

Applicants must hold a bachelor's degree from a regionally accredited institution and have a cumulative grade point average of 2.5 or better (on a 4.0 point scale). Those with a 2.0 and 2.49 may be granted conditional admission, which will be removed once your GPA reaches 3.0 or better after the completion of the first nine credit hours.

Transfer Credits

A maximum of six graduate credits, completed with a grade of B or better, may be transferred from other institutions.

These transfer courses must be related to degree requirements offered in the organizational communications program or acceptable substitutes for electives taken from other programs of Bowie State University’s Graduate School.

  • Transfer credits must remain within a total span of seven years, and there is a seven-year limit to the program.
  • Credits are not accepted in practicum, applied research or seminar courses.
  • Credits used to complete one master’s degree may not be used toward another master’s degree.
  • Credits may not be used for more than one degree at the graduate level.
